The mission of The Laughing Feet Performers is to inspire relationships between individuals with special needs and their typical peers through musical and artistic expression as well as give performance opportunities to those who would normally not have them.

Laughing Feet Is Now An Offical Non-Profit
Laughing Feet received non-profit status in July 2011 and tax exempt status in December 2011. Any donations made to Laughing Feet Performers are now tax deductible. If you made a donation prior to December 2011 you should have received an email with the tax ID number indicating your donation is retroactively tax deductable.
